HOW WHAT IS MD5'S APPLICATION CAN SAVE YOU TIME, STRESS, AND MONEY.

How what is md5's application can Save You Time, Stress, and Money.

How what is md5's application can Save You Time, Stress, and Money.

Blog Article

MD5 is a broadly utilised hash function that creates a concept digest (or hash price) of 128 bits in size. It had been originally intended for a cryptographic hash purpose but, in a later on phase vulnerabilities ended up uncovered and as a consequence isn't deemed appropriate for cryptographic applications.

Info Integrity Verification: MD5 is often applied to check the integrity of data files. Each time a file is transferred, its MD5 hash may be as opposed ahead of and following the transfer making sure that it has not been altered.

A hash operate like MD5 that's been proven susceptible to certain forms of assaults, which include collisions.

These hashing features not just deliver greater safety but will also incorporate attributes like salting and vital stretching to more enhance password security.

Given the vulnerabilities of MD5, safer hash capabilities are now encouraged for cryptographic functions:

Instruction and Consciousness: Educate staff with regards to the hazards linked to outdated safety tactics and the significance of staying latest with business finest methods.

Collision Vulnerabilities: In 2004, researchers shown that MD5 is prone to collision attacks, exactly where two unique inputs can deliver the same hash. This is particularly unsafe as it will allow an attacker to substitute a malicious file or message for just a respectable just one while sustaining a similar hash worth, bypassing integrity checks. Preimage and Second Preimage Attacks: Although preimage assaults (getting an enter that hashes to a specific hash) and second preimage attacks (discovering a special input that creates the identical hash like a presented input) are still computationally challenging for MD5, the vulnerabilities in collision resistance make MD5 much less secure for modern Cryptographic Methods applications.

This time, we’ll be zeroing in on what in fact transpires when data goes with the MD5 hashing algorithm. How can a thing like “They are deterministic” (This really is simply a random sentence we used in the other report) get was a 128-bit hash such as this?

Whilst less typical right now on account of protection worries, MD5 was the moment commonly Utilized in the development of electronic signatures. The hash of the information can be encrypted with A non-public crucial to make the digital signature, as well as the recipient would verify it using a public vital.

MD5’s padding scheme looks rather strange. Following laying out the Preliminary 176 bits of binary that characterize our enter, the remainder of the block is padded with a single 1, then ample zeros to provide it nearly a duration of 448 bits. So:

Simplicity: The MD5 algorithm is straightforward to employ, and its large support across platforms and programming languages makes certain compatibility with lots of existing methods.

Businesses can phase out MD5 authentication in legacy devices by conducting a danger evaluation, prioritizing crucial devices, choosing suited options, extensive testing, person training, and little by little migrating to more secure authentication approaches.

The commonest application of your MD5 algorithm has become to examine documents integrity after a transfer. By producing a MD5 file prior to and after a file transfer, it’s possible to identify any corruption. MD5 is usually continue to utilized to keep passwords in a few databases, even though it’s no longer safe.

A preimage assault attempts to reverse-engineer the first input from its hash. When significantly less practical than collision assaults, MD5 website can also be at risk of this kind of assault, especially when useful for sensitive facts like passwords.

Report this page